EI Premium Reduction Program

���53November 2014

Page 54: 2014 Beneplan Plan Administrator's Workshop

Beneplan.ca All rights reserved Beneplan Inc 2014

A program which is designed to reduce the employer’s EI premiums payable if that employer provides wage loss replacement coverage that meets Human Resources and Skills Development Canada’s requirements !

To be considered for premium reduction, a plan that provides short-term disability benefits must: ! - provide at least 15 weeks of benefits; - match or exceed the level of benefits provided by EI; - pay benefits to employees after 14 days of illness or injury; - be accessible to employees within 3 months of hiring; - cover employees on a 24-hour-a-day basis. - pass on the savings to employees for their portion

EI Premium Reduction Program

How EI Sickness and WI programs interact • The WI program is a replacement for EI sickness benefit • You elect to have one or the other • If you wish to keep the EI sickness program, but you don’t like their

maximums, or their waiting periods, it’s possible to co-ordinate both benefits by using the supplementary unemployment insurance sickness benefit (SUB)

• The SUB plan must be registered with EI • The SUB plan needs to be drafted to indicate exactly what’s offered • EI requires a 2-week waiting period, the SUB plan can make payments

during these 2 weeks without interfering with EI sickness plan • EI would offset some payments from the employer, however, if a SUB

plan is in place, EI will not offset any top-up payments to improve the maximum

Benefits extensions• The employee quits or resigns with notice - The termination date would be the last day worked. !• The employee is being fired for cause - Terminate the coverage on the day the employee is fired. !• Voluntary leave of absence - The company may choose to suspend or extend benefits ! - Let us know before you offer to extend benefits. ! - Your decision must be communicated in writing to the employee. ! - If the company chooses to extend benefits, LOA is required.

Transition

Page 70: 2014 Beneplan Plan Administrator's Workshop

Terminations / Non Active Employees

• Company Lay off – the layoff expected to be less than 13 weeks !• The Employment Standards Act (ESA) states that companies that lay

employees off temporarily up to 13weeks, are not deemed to have terminated these employees; !

• In this case, the company may choose to suspend benefits during such layoff or may choose to extend benefits during the layoff. !

• If the company chooses to extend such coverage, the company must apply for a Letter of Agreement (LOA). !

• All benefits, with the exception of short/long-term disability, out-of- country coverage and weekly indemnity can be continued, up to 13 weeks. After 13 weeks, only health & dental may be covered, up to 35 weeks. !

• This must be documented by the way of LOA.

Page 71: 2014 Beneplan Plan Administrator's Workshop

Terminations / Non Active Employees

• Company Layoff – the layoff expected to be more than 13 weeks !The Employment Standards Act (ESA) states that companies that lay employees off for longer than 13 weeks, the employees are not deemed terminated if the company extends all their benefits. !In this case the company must apply for a Letter of Agreement (LOA). !All benefits, with the exception of short/long-term disability and out-of- country coverage can be continued, for a period of up to one year. This must be documented by the way of LOA.

Terminations6. Benefits during the notice period !The ESA requires that all benefits, including disability, must continue, whether the employee is actively working or not, for the number of weeks, set out by the Employment Standards Act (ESA)

For Ontario:Working for 3 months or more; less than 1 year (1 week)

1 year or more; less than 2 years (2 weeks)3 years or more; less than 4 years (3 weeks)4 years or more; less than 5 years (4 weeks)5 years or more; less than 6 years (5 weeks)6 years or more; less than 7 years (6 weeks)7 years or more; less than 8 years (7 weeks)

8 years or more (8 weeks)

Terminations / Non Active Employees

• Severance - Extension of benefits beyond the “Notice Period” requires legal documentation between the employer and the insurance carrier. ! - All benefits would be extended, with the exclusion of any disabilities (short or long) and out-of-country coverage (on health). ! - The employer must inform Beneplan if they wish to extend benefits beyond the termination date or notice period. ! - An LOA is required in this case.

Ask us before you offer a package!

Out of Country Coverage• Absolutely critical to call the

number on their out of country card before paying the any foreign medical provider !

• Upon calling, the insurance company negotiates a fair market price with the medical provider !

• If they are not called, it is possible the employee will be overcharged and not be able to claim the full amount upon return to Canada !

• Communicate this to all employees

Other Leaves-per the Employment Standards Act (ESA)

• Compassionate Leave (Family Medical Leave) - Under the ESA the employee is eligible to family medical leave up to eight weeks job-protected leave. ! - The coverage will be extended for all benefits in effect prior to the leave. Employers must continue paying their share of benefits premiums. !• Pregnancy/Maternity/Paternity Leave -Under the ESA where an employee takes maternity/paternity leave, the employer must keep all of the benefits that were in force prior to the leave. ! - If premiums for WI and LTD are paid during maternity/parental leave and the employee will be eligible for disability coverage. ! - If premiums are not paid, there would be no disability coverage. ! - No letter of agreement is required here.

Page 85: 2014 Beneplan Plan Administrator's Workshop

Other Leaves-per the Employment Standards Act (ESA)

• Emergency Leave - Under the ESA if the employee is entitled to personal emergency leave then the employee will be on an unpaid, job-protected leave of up to 10 days each calendar year. ! - The employer must continue benefits while an employee is on personal leave. !• Vacation Periods Extended - If the employee on vacation (either in or out of country) and the employer decides to allow the employee to extend the employee’s vacation, then coverage for all benefits would continue to be in force. ! - No letter of agreement is required here.

Page 86: 2014 Beneplan Plan Administrator's Workshop

New Leaves-per the Employment Standards Act (ESA)

Family Caregiver Leave!!

•Up to eight weeks of unpaid, job-protected leave for employees to provide care or support to a family member with a serious medical condition.!!

Critically Ill Child Care Leave!!

•Up to 37 weeks of unpaid, job-protected leave to provide care to a critically ill child.!!

Crime-Related Child Death or Disappearance Leave!!

•Unpaid, job-protected leave for parents whose child is missing or has died as a result of a crime.!!Must extend their benefits during this time.
